🔬 The Science Behind Visualization
Research involving athletes, performers, entrepreneurs, and professionals has shown that mental rehearsal activates many of the same neural pathways used during actual performance. The brain often responds to vividly imagined experiences in ways surprisingly similar to real experiences.
Repeated visualization helps create familiarity with desired outcomes, reducing uncertainty and reinforcing confidence. It trains attention toward opportunities and actions that support specific goals.
🎯 The Six-Repetition Visualization Method
Choose a peaceful environment free from distractions.
Take slow, deep breaths and allow the body to release tension.
Visualize your goal as if it has already become reality.
Feel the excitement, gratitude, confidence, and satisfaction associated with success.
Mentally revisit the same image with clarity and consistency.
Finish the session feeling motivated and ready to take action.

⚠️ Important Perspective
Visualization is not a substitute for action. It does not magically create results. Instead, it helps train attention, strengthen confidence, and reinforce the mindset necessary for meaningful achievement.
The most effective approach combines clear mental imagery with consistent effort, disciplined habits, and practical action.
